SORU
12 EYLÜL 2011, PAZARTESİ


Neden yöntemleri ve nitelikleri üzerinde görüş miktarını önemli?

Neden tüm yöntemleri ve özellikleri ile her yerden erişilebilir (0 *yani*) bırakmamız gerekmez mi?

Yapabilirsinizbana bir örnek verbir sorun varsa public gibi bir öznitelik ilan edersem içine çalıştırabilirsiniz?

CEVAP
12 EYLÜL 2011, PAZARTESİ


Neden tüm yöntemleri ve özellikleri ile her yerden erişilebilir (yani kamu) bırakmamız gerekmez mi?

Çok pahalı olduğu için.

Bu onların ortak yöntem dikkatli olmak zorundatasarlanmışve sonraonayladımimarlardan oluşan bir ekip tarafından, olmalıuygulanmaktadırolmakkeyfi düşmanca veya hatalı arayanlar karşısında sağlamolmalıtamamen test edilmiştüm sorunlar test sırasında bulmuşregresyon suiteseklenen yeni bir yöntem olmalıbelgelenmişbelgelere olmalıtercümeen azından on iki farklı dilde.

En büyük maliyet:bu yöntem, değişmeden korunmalı, sonsuza kadar, Amin. Eğer bu yöntemi yaptıklarını sevmediğim bir sonraki sürümünde karar verirsem, müşteriler artık ona güveniyor, çünkü bunu değiştiremem. Geriye ortak bir yöntem uyumluluk kesiliyorgetirir kullanıcıların maliyetlerive bunu yapmak için nefret ediyorum. Genel bir yöntem kötü bir tasarım ya da uygulama ile yaşam bir sonraki sürümü tasarımcılar, Test ve uygulayıcıları üzerinde yüksek maliyetler getirir.

Genel bir yöntem kolayca binlerce ya da on binlerce dolar bile mal olabilir. Bir sınıf içinde bir yüz ve işte milyon dolarlık bir sınıf.

Özel yöntemler, bu masrafların hiçbiri yok.Hissedar akıllıca para harcamak; her şey olabilir özel olun.

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• BumbleDroid

    BumbleDroid

    18 EKİM 2010
  • discokatze

    discokatze

    23 EYLÜL 2009
  • taliajoy18

    taliajoy18

    12 Temmuz 2011